Contemporary accounts and survivors' stories of the 'unsinkable' liner; The story of the sinking of the great liner, Titanic, has been told countless times since that fateful night on 14th April 1912 by authors and film producers alike, but no account is as graphic or revealing as those who were actually there. Through survivors' tales, and contemporary newspaper reports from both sides of the Atlantic, The Mammoth Book of How it Happened: the Titanic strips away the Hollywood gloss and tells the real story of the 'unsinkable' vessel. Here are eye-witness accounts full of details that range from poignant to humorous, stage by stage from her glorious launch in Belfast to the sombre sea burial services of those who perished on her first and only voyage.
